Pre-trial Problems of Launch 9. What are some regular Problems of Launch? Pretrial Services team as well as the Court might impose nonfinancial problems of launch, which may call for that the arrested person do any Get the facts of the following: Continue to be under the supervision of a designated person or company; Comply with restrictions on the customer's traveling, people they connect with or where they live; Not engage in specified activities, including the use or possession of a dangerous tool, an intoxicant or managed substance; Prevent all call with a claimed victim of the criminal activity and also with a prospective witness that may affirm regarding the offense; or Please any type of various other problem that is fairly needed to assure that the customer pertains to court.

What happens if a person does not follow their conditions of launch? If a client does not obey their problems of release, they can be billed with a new crime or their bond can be modified or revoked by the court and also a new bond enforced. What is the Damaged Driving Intervention Program (IDIP)? IDIP is offered for certain customers that are billed with driving an automobile or a boat under the influence of alcohol or medicines. IDIP provides eligible clients the possibility to obtain alcohol education and learning or compound misuse therapy without going to trial.
